Title :
Analyses of a bidirectional DC-DC half-bridge converter with zero voltage switching

Abstract :
A survey of important data (maximum voltage and current ratings for the elements, rms values for the semiconductor devices and a rough approximation of the losses) of a half-bridge bidirectional DC/DC converter is given. A realistic converter model is derived. The transfer function for output voltage depending on the duty cycle and the transfer function for coupling of two voltage sources are calculated and the function of a zero voltage switching concept is explained.
